Business Leaders
Daisy Maryles -- 1/5/98


Official pub date for Die Broke: A Radical Four-Part Financial Plan by Stephen M. Pollan and Mark Levine was not scheduled until January 9, but HarperBusiness has already had an impressive bestseller run with this title and is anticipating more action this month. Happily, Pollan's four simple maxims -- don't retire, quit today, pay cash and die broke -- caught Oprah's attention, and she wanted to air a show about it at the end of October. Luckily, since Pollan was one of those rare authors with a finished manuscript ahead of time, HB was able to comply and a quick production schedule got the book into stores the week Pollan was on Oprah. Sales were strong enough to land the book among the top-five business titles on both USA Today's business bestseller list as well as on Business Week's monthly list (where it's still #3). The Oprah appearance will be rebroadcast January 9. HarperBusiness has gone back to press 10 times, bringing the in-print total to 110,000 copies.
